Situated at 94 Wale Street, Bo‑Kaap, the Bo‑Kaap Bazaar is a lively boutique market offering an authentic taste of Cape Malay culture.

🛍 What You’ll Find

  • A curated selection of locally made crafts: pottery, jewelry, clothing, bronze castings, ostrich leather goods, and more from across Africa.
  • Bo‑Kaap Bite counter serves freshly pressed coffee, toasted sandwiches, Cape Malay snacks, plus samosas and koeksisters—perfect for a quick, flavorful break.
  • A cozy spot to rent bicycles and explore colorful cobbled streets just steps away.

🌍 Why Visit?

  • Authentic community connection: Meet local artisans and hear stories behind their creations.
  • Cultural treats & caffeine: Enjoy Cape Malay flavours and coffee while browsing.
  • Central & colorful: Located in Bo‑Kaap—a UNESCO-protected neighborhood known for its vibrant history and pastel houses.

💡 Insider Tips

  • Visit Monday–Saturday for the full selection; Saturday offers shorter hours.
  • Combine your visit with a stroll through Bo‑Kaap’s iconic streets, nearby spice shops like Atlas Trading, or the monthly First‑Saturday Bo‑Kaap Food & Craft Market at Upper Wale Street.
  • Early mornings and late afternoons are best for quieter shopping and Instagram-worthy photos.
